Brand Hackers builds experienced, dynamic, and fractional teams that fit in like puzzle pieces, providing just the right knowledge and energy at the right time. We’re not your typical agency or a one-man show. We are a team of passionate professionals who live and breathe branding and marketing. With over 100 startup brands under our belt, our team combines strategic thinking with sharp execution. We’ve grown 30 to 50% year on year since 2020 and are now looking for a marketing leader to help drive the quality, pace and impact of our work to the next level.
There are currently more than 20 in the team, structured into a Growth Pod, a Brand Pod and a Social Pod. Brand Hackers is part of Up Collective, alongside Up World (a community and curated learning platform for entrepreneurial marketers) and Up Talent (marketing-focused recruitment). We operate as one business internally.
The Role
We’re looking for a senior marketing leader to shape the quality of our thinking, lead our team and bring clarity to complex challenges. You’ll be responsible for ensuring the standard of all marketing strategy across Brand Hackers is exceptional, and that our team are continually learning, stretching to change the trajectory of the brands we work with.
You’ll be nurturing a big & growing team of ambitious marketers who look to you for guidance, energy and clarity, being hands-on with our highest priority projects and building the reputation of the business in the industry.
The role will have 3-5 direct reports, with ultimate responsibility for the full Brand Hackers team. The role will report into Lottie, Founder, when she is back from maternity leave and will be looked after by Chessie in the interim.
